Sunday, October 15, 2023
HomeSoftware EngineeringEasy methods to Use an AI Implementation Technique

Easy methods to Use an AI Implementation Technique


That is half 3 in a three-part sequence on AI digital product administration. Within the first two installments, I launched the fundamentals of machine studying and outlined create an AI product technique. On this article, I focus on apply these classes to construct an AI product.

Constructing an AI product is a fancy and iterative course of involving a number of disciplines and stakeholders. An implementation framework ensures that your AI product supplies most worth with minimal value and energy. The one I describe on this article combines Agile and Lean startup product administration rules to construct customer-centric merchandise and unify groups throughout disparate fields.

Every part of this text corresponds to a stage of this framework, starting with discovery.

The discovery stage tests the hypothesis; validation builds it incrementally; scaling commits resources to validated products.
This high-level view of the AI implementation framework comprises all the elemental steps for product supply.

AI Product Discovery

In half 2 of this sequence, I described plan a product technique and an AI technique that helps it. Within the technique stage, we used discovery as a preliminary step to establish prospects, issues, and potential options with out worrying about AI tech necessities. Nonetheless, discovery is greater than a one-time analysis push firstly of a challenge; it’s an ongoing mandate to hunt and consider new proof to make sure that the product is transferring in a helpful and worthwhile path.

Within the implementation stage, discovery will assist us assess the proposed AI product’s worth to prospects inside the technical limits we established within the AI technique. Revisiting discovery may even assist establish the AI product’s core worth, often known as the worth proposition.

Construction the Speculation

Persevering with an instance from the earlier article on this sequence, suppose an airline has employed you as a product supervisor to spice up gross sales of underperforming routes. After researching the issue and evaluating a number of answer hypotheses throughout technique planning, you determine to pursue a flight-demand prediction product.

At this stage, deepen your analysis so as to add element to the speculation. How will the product perform, who’s it for, and the way will it generate income?

Gather info on prospects, opponents, and {industry} developments to broaden the speculation:

Analysis Goal

Objective

Sources

Prospects

Uncover what options prospects worth.

  • On-line evaluations
  • Interviews
  • Demographic statistics

Opponents

Study buyer notion, funding ranges and sources, product launches, and struggles and achievements.

Business Traits

Hold tempo with developments in expertise and enterprise practices.

  • Commerce publications
  • On-line boards
  • Networking occasions

Subsequent, arrange your findings to establish patterns within the analysis. On this instance, you establish the product needs to be marketed to journey brokers in tier 2 cities who will promote offers on unsold seats. If all goes nicely, you intend to scale the product by providing it to competitor airways.

Structure analysis findings into actionable and measurable statements:

Buyer

Drawback

Buyer Purpose

Potential Options

Riskiest Assumption

Journey brokers in tier 2 cities

Incapacity to foretell flight prices and availability fluctuations

Maximize earnings

  • An AI-powered flight-demand predictor
  • An combination market evaluation for flight demand

Journey brokers will use a flight-demand predictor to make selections for his or her enterprise.

Based mostly on the areas of inquiry you’ve pursued, you may start structuring MVP statements.

One MVP assertion may learn:

40% of journey brokers will use a flight-demand prediction product if the mannequin’s accuracy exceeds 90%.

Be aware: Not like the exploratory MVP statements within the technique section, this MVP assertion combines the product idea (a flight-demand predictor) with the expertise that powers it (an AI mannequin).

After you have listed all MVP statements, prioritize them primarily based on three components:

  • Desirability: How necessary is that this product to the shopper?
  • Viability: Will the product fulfill the product imaginative and prescient outlined within the technique?
  • Feasibility: Do you have got the time, cash, and organizational assist to construct this product?

Check the Speculation

In speculation testing, you’ll market and distribute prototypes of various constancy (similar to storyboards and static or interactive wireframes) to gauge preliminary buyer curiosity on this potential AI product.

The speculation will decide which testing strategies you utilize. As an example, touchdown web page exams will assist measure demand for a brand new product. Hurdle exams are finest if you’re including new options to an current product, and smoke exams consider person responses to a specific number of options.

Speculation Testing Strategies

Touchdown Web page Check

Construct a sequence of touchdown pages selling completely different variations of your answer. Promote the pages on social media and measure which one will get probably the most visits or sign-ups.

Hurdle Check

Construct easy, interactive wireframes however make them tough to make use of. Including UX friction will assist gauge how motivated customers are to entry your product. If you happen to retain a predefined proportion of customers, there’s probably wholesome demand.

UX Smoke Check

Market high-fidelity interactive wireframes and observe how customers navigate them.

Be aware: Doc the hypotheses and outcomes as soon as testing is full to assist decide the product’s worth proposition. I like Lean Canvas for its one-page, at-a-glance format.

On the finish of AI product discovery, you’ll know which answer to construct, who you’re making it for, and its core worth. If proof signifies that prospects will purchase your AI product, you’ll construct a full MVP within the validation section.

Dash Tip

Many sprints should run in parallel to accommodate the AI product’s complexity and the product staff’s array of personnel and disciplines. Within the AI product discovery section, the enterprise, advertising and marketing, and design groups will work in sprints to rapidly establish the shopper, drawback assertion, and hypothesized answer.

AI Product Validation

Within the AI product validation stage, you’ll use an Agile experimental format to construct your AI product incrementally. Which means processing knowledge and increasing the AI mannequin piecemeal, gauging buyer curiosity at each step.

Validating an AI product entails building infrastructure, processing data for modeling, deployment, and customer validation.

As a result of your AI product probably includes a massive amount of information and lots of stakeholders, your construct needs to be extremely structured. Right here’s how I handle mine:

1. Put together the Infrastructure

The infrastructure encompasses each course of required to coach, preserve, and launch the AI algorithm. Since you’ll construct the mannequin in a managed surroundings, a strong infrastructure is one of the best ways to organize for the unknowns of the actual world.

Half 2 of this sequence lined tech and infrastructure planning. Now it’s time to construct that infrastructure earlier than creating the machine studying (ML) mannequin. Constructing the infrastructure requires finalizing your method to knowledge assortment, storage, processing, and safety, in addition to creating your plans for the mannequin’s upkeep, enchancment, and course correction ought to it behave unpredictably.

Right here’s a downloadable step-by-step information to get you began.

2. Information Processing and Modeling

Work with area specialists and knowledge engineers to focus on, acquire, and preprocess a high-quality growth knowledge set. Accessing knowledge in a company setting will probably contain a gauntlet of bureaucratic approvals, so ensure that to scope out loads of time. After you have the event set, the information science staff can create the ML mannequin.

Goal and acquire. The area professional in your staff will allow you to find and perceive the out there knowledge, which ought to fulfill the 4 Cs: appropriate, present, constant, and linked. Seek the advice of along with your area professional early and infrequently. I’ve labored on initiatives by which nonexperts made many false assumptions whereas figuring out knowledge, resulting in pricey machine studying issues later within the growth course of.

Subsequent, decide which of the out there knowledge belongs in your growth set. Weed out discontinuous, irrelevant, or one-off knowledge.

At this level, assess whether or not the information set mirrors real-world situations. It might be tempting to hurry up the method by coaching your algorithm on dummy or nonproduction knowledge, however this may waste time in the long term. The capabilities that end result are normally inaccurate and would require in depth work later within the growth course of.

Preprocess. After you have recognized the fitting knowledge set, the information engineering staff will refine it, convert it right into a standardized format, and retailer it in accordance with the information science staff’s specs. This course of has three steps:

  1. Cleansing: Removes inaccurate or duplicative knowledge from the set.
  2. Wrangling: Converts uncooked knowledge into accessible codecs.
  3. Sampling: Creates buildings that allow the information science staff to take samples for an preliminary evaluation.

Modeling is the place the actual work of a knowledge scientist begins. On this step, the information scientists will work inside the infrastructure’s parameters and choose an algorithm that solves the shopper’s drawback and fits the product options and knowledge.

Earlier than testing these algorithms, the information scientists should know the product’s core options. These options are derived from the drawback assertion and answer you recognized within the AI product discovery section in the beginning of this text.

Optimize the options. Tremendous-tune options to spice up mannequin efficiency and decide whether or not you want completely different ones.

Practice the mannequin. The mannequin’s success depends upon the event and coaching knowledge units. If you don’t choose these rigorously, problems will come up afterward. Ideally, you need to select each knowledge units randomly from the identical knowledge supply. The larger the information set, the higher the algorithm will carry out.

Information scientists apply knowledge to completely different fashions within the growth surroundings to check their studying algorithms. This step includes hyperparameter tuning, retraining fashions, and mannequin administration. If the event set performs nicely, purpose for the same stage of efficiency from the coaching set. Regularization will help make sure that the mannequin’s match inside the knowledge set is balanced. When the mannequin doesn’t carry out nicely, it’s normally attributable to variance, bias, or each. Prejudicial bias in buyer knowledge derives from interpretations of things similar to gender, race, and site. Eradicating human preconceptions from the information and making use of methods similar to regularization can enhance these points.

Consider the mannequin. In the beginning of the challenge, the information scientists ought to choose analysis metrics to gauge the standard of the machine studying mannequin. The less metrics, the higher.

The information scientists will cross-validate outcomes with completely different fashions to see whether or not they chosen one of the best one. The profitable mannequin’s algorithm will produce a perform that almost all intently represents the information within the coaching set. The information scientists will then place the mannequin in take a look at environments to look at its efficiency. If the mannequin performs nicely, it’s prepared for deployment.

Dash Tip

Throughout the mannequin growth section, the knowledge engineering and knowledge science groups will run devoted sprints in parallel, with shared dash evaluations to change key learnings.

The early sprints of the knowledge engineering staff will construct area understanding and establish knowledge sources. The subsequent few sprints can give attention to processing the information right into a usable format. On the finish of every dash, solicit suggestions from the information science staff and the broader product growth staff.

The knowledge science staff could have targets for every dash, together with enabling area understanding, sampling the fitting knowledge units, engineering product options, choosing the proper algorithm, adjusting coaching units, and guaranteeing efficiency.

3. Deployment and Buyer Validation

It’s time to organize your mannequin for deployment in the actual world.

Finalize the UX. The deployed mannequin should seamlessly work together with the shopper. What is going to that buyer journey seem like? What sort of interplay will set off the machine studying mannequin if the AI product is an app or web site? Do not forget that if the tip person sees and interacts with the mannequin, you’ll probably want entry to internet providers or APIs.

Plan updates. The knowledge scientists and analysis scientists should always replace the deployed mannequin to make sure that its accuracy will enhance because it encounters extra knowledge. Resolve how and when to do that.

Guarantee security and compliance. Allow industry-specific compliance practices and set up a fail-safe mechanism that kicks in when the mannequin doesn’t behave as anticipated.

As for validation, use built-in monitoring options to gather buyer interactions. Earlier buyer interactions (interviews, demos, and so forth.) might need helped you perceive what options prospects need, however observing them in motion will inform you whether or not you’ve delivered efficiently. As an example, if you’re constructing a cell app, chances are you’ll wish to observe which button the shopper clicks on probably the most and the navigation journeys they take via the app.

The buyer validation section will furnish a data-backed evaluation that may inform you whether or not to speculate extra time in particular app options.

No product is ever proper on the primary attempt, so don’t hand over. It takes about three iterations to impress prospects. Look ahead to these three iterations. Study from the proof, return to the drafting board, and add and modify options.

Dash Tip

Throughout product deployment, the engineering, advertising and marketing, and enterprise groups will run parallel sprints when making ready to deploy the mannequin. As soon as the mannequin is working, the deployment staff will deal with updates primarily based on person suggestions.

Institute a course of among the many engineering, advertising and marketing, knowledge science, and enterprise groups to check and enhance the mannequin. Create an iteration construction designed to implement the suggestions from this course of. Divide this work into sprints devoted to launching a brand new characteristic, working exams, or amassing person suggestions.

AI Product Scaling

At this stage, you’ll have recognized your buyer and gathered real-time suggestions. Now it’s time to put money into the product by scaling within the following areas:

Enterprise mannequin: At this level, you’ll have proof of how a lot it prices to accumulate a brand new buyer and the way a lot every buyer is prepared to pay to your product. If vital, pivot your online business mannequin to make sure you obtain your revenue aims. Relying in your preliminary product imaginative and prescient, you may select one-time funds or SaaS-based fashions.

Group construction: How and when do you add extra folks to the staff as you construct out your product? Are key gamers lacking?

Product positioning: What positioning and messaging are working nicely for the shopper? How will you capitalize on and entice extra prospects inside your chosen demographic?

Operations: What occurs when one thing goes incorrect? Who will the shopper name?

Viewers: Take heed to buyer communications and social media posts. Rising your buyer base additionally means rising your product, so hold adjusting and bettering in response to buyer calls for. To do that, return to discovery to analysis potential new options, take a look at your hypotheses, and create your subsequent product iteration.

AI Product Shortcuts

If constructing an AI product from scratch is just too onerous or costly, attempt leaning on third-party AI instruments. For instance, SparkAI presents a ready-made AI infrastructure that may shorten growth time, and open-source frameworks similar to Kafka and Databricks ingest, course of, and retailer knowledge for ML mannequin growth. Amazon Mechanical Turk speeds mannequin coaching by crowdsourcing human labor for duties similar to labeling coaching knowledge.

If it’s worthwhile to make sense of huge portions of information, as in sentiment evaluation, AI as a service (AIaaS) merchandise like MonkeyLearn can tag, analyze, and create visualizations and not using a single piece of code. For extra advanced issues, DataRobot presents an all-in-one cloud-based AI platform that handles every part from importing knowledge to creating and making use of AI fashions.

AI Is Simply Getting Began

I’ve lined the what, why, and the way of AI implementation, however a wealth of moral and authorized concerns fall outdoors the scope of this sequence. Self-driving automobiles, good medical gadgets, and instruments similar to Dall-E 2 and ChatGPT are poised to problem long-held assumptions about human thought, labor, and creativity. No matter your views, this new period has already arrived.

AI has the potential to energy distinctive instruments and providers. These of us who harness it ought to accomplish that thoughtfully, with an eye fixed towards how our selections will have an effect on future customers.

Do you have got ideas about AI and the way forward for product administration? Please share them within the feedback.

For product administration suggestions, try Mayank’s guide, The Artwork of Constructing Nice Merchandise.



Supply hyperlink

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

- Advertisment -
Google search engine

Most Popular

Recent Comments